21xrx.com
2024-11-22 06:06:08 Friday
登录
文章检索 我的文章 写文章
使用C++编程实现分形图形设计
2023-07-05 13:50:14 深夜i     --     --
C++ 编程 分形图形 设计 实现

分形图形设计是一种以递归的方式生成图形的方法。使用C++编程可以很好地实现分形图形设计。下面将介绍如何使用C++编程实现分形图形设计。

1. 确定分形图形的类型

首先需要确定分形图形的类型,比如海龟曲线,科赫曲线等。确定类型后需要了解分形图形的生成规则,以便编程实现。

2. 编写递归函数

编写递归函数来生成分形图形是实现分形图形设计的重要步骤。递归函数要根据分形图形的类型和生成规则编写。通常,递归函数需要输入参数来确定分形图形的大小和形状。

3. 绘制分形图形

使用C++编写绘图函数,将递归函数生成的图形绘制出来。绘图函数需要调用C++的绘图库,比如OpenGL、Qt等。

4. 调用递归函数生成分形图形

在主函数中调用递归函数,生成分形图形。可以通过修改输入参数来控制分形图形的大小和形状。生成的分形图形可以保存到文件中,或者实时显示出来。

总之,使用C++编程实现分形图形设计需要对分形图形的类型和生成规则有一定的了解,同时需要掌握C++的编程语言和绘图库。通过不断实践和尝试,可以编写出各种形态的分形图形,为数学美学和计算机造型艺术注入新的灵感和生命力。

  
  
下一篇: C++内联函数

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章